Understanding the Impact of Mental Health in Elite Sports

The recent passing of John Brenkus, the esteemed host of ‘Sport Science,’ underscores a critical and often overlooked aspect of athletics—mental health. Elite athletes are frequently lauded for their physical prowess, yet their mental well-being can be just as crucial, if not more so, to their performance. Statistics reveal that athletes are just as vulnerable to mental health issues as anyone else, facing unique pressures such as public scrutiny, competition stress, and the demands of training regimens. The culture surrounding elite sports often stigmatizes mental health challenges, prompting many athletes to suffer in silence, as they fear for their careers, reputations, and endorsements.

Moreover, the impact of mental health on performance cannot be understated. Key factors include:

  • Performance Anxiety: Increased stress can lead to decreased effectiveness during competitions.
  • Burnout: Prolonged mental strain may result in exhaustion, affecting not just performance but overall life satisfaction.
  • Injuries: Mental health issues can prolong recovery times, as the mind plays a significant role in physical healing.

As the conversation about mental health in sports evolves, it becomes essential for organizations and support systems to implement comprehensive strategies that prioritize psychological wellness. Tackling this stigma may encourage more athletes to seek help, ensuring they have not just the physical tools, but also the emotional resilience required to excel in their fields.

Strategies for Supporting Mental Wellbeing in Athletic Communities

Enhancing mental wellbeing in athletic communities is vital, especially in the wake of tragedies such as the loss of notable figures like John Brenkus. Sports organizations can play a significant role by implementing support systems tailored to the unique pressures faced by athletes. Some effective strategies include:

  • Promoting open conversations: Creating a culture where athletes feel safe discussing their mental health struggles without stigma can facilitate early intervention and support.
  • Access to professional counseling: Ensuring that athletes have access to licensed mental health professionals who specialize in sports-related issues can help in addressing mental health challenges effectively.
  • Educational programs: Workshops that educate athletes about mental health, coping mechanisms, and stress management can empower them to take charge of their mental wellbeing.
  • Peer support initiatives: Establishing mentorship or buddy systems among athletes can foster community and provide a vital support network.
